In the scenario involving GE electrical assemblies, the current production process is a moving assembly line. This means that the product goes through a series of stations where operators add parts or make adjustments until the product is finished. The operators on the assembly line are responsible for maintaining a consistent pace of work to ensure the smooth flow of production. The production rate of product X is directly related to the efficiency and speed of the operators on the assembly line.
